Background
The ball valve is driven by the valve rod, and the valve of rotary motion is made around the ball valve axis, it is used for fluidic regulation and control also to do, wherein have very strong shearing force between its V type ball core of hard seal V type ball valve and the metal disk seat of build-up welding carbide, specially adapted contains the medium of fibre, small solid particle etc., and the multiple-way ball valve not only can nimble control the confluence of medium on the pipeline, reposition of redundant personnel, and the switching of flow direction, also can close arbitrary passageway simultaneously and make two other passageways link to each other, this type of valve should horizontal installation generally in the pipeline, the ball valve divide into according to the drive mode: pneumatic ball valve, electronic ball valve, manual ball valve need use full latus rectum welding steel ball valve at the in-process that liquefied natural gas or liquefied petroleum gas used.
Through the retrieval, patent publication No. CN208153767U discloses a full latus rectum welding ball valve, and the valve body both ends all are equipped with the extension pipe that one end was arranged in the valve body inside, and the valve core that is equipped with two extension pipe one end and closely laminates is equipped with coupling assembling in the valve body inside, and the extension pipe is equipped with the well axle sleeve with the crossing department of valve body on the valve body, and well axle sleeve inside is equipped with the axis, is equipped with the bearing between axis and the well axle sleeve, is equipped with the ring dress baffle on the extension pipe lateral wall.
The existing full-bore welded steel ball valve has the defects that:
1. the existing full-bore welded steel ball valve is inconvenient for workers to install and influences the use of the workers;
2. the adjusting frame of the existing full-bore welded steel ball valve is easy to damage in the using process, so that the device cannot be used.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ide a full latus rectum welding steel ball valve to solve the problem that proposes among the above-mentioned background art.
In order to achieve the above object, the utility model provides a following technical scheme: the utility model provides a full latus rectum welding steel ball valve, includes valve body, flexible subassembly and locating component, the both sides all movable mounting at locating component top have flexible subassembly, the fixed valve body that is provided with in top of flexible subassembly, the inside of valve body runs through and installs the valve rod, the top fixed mounting of valve rod has the inserted block, the top fixed mounting of inserted block has adjusting part, the inside both sides of locating component all run through and install the pilot pin.
Preferably, the adjusting component comprises an adjusting frame, and a slot is fixedly arranged at the bottom of the adjusting frame.
Preferably, the bottom of the valve rod is fixedly provided with a valve, and the bottom of the valve is fixedly provided with a valve seat.
Preferably, the inside of valve body is fixed and is provided with full siphunculus, and the both sides of full siphunculus all are fixed and are provided with the mounting disc, and the inside both ends of mounting disc all are fixed and are provided with the mounting hole.
Preferably, the telescopic assembly comprises a telescopic sleeve, a telescopic rod is movably mounted inside the telescopic sleeve, and adjusting bolts are movably mounted on two sides of the telescopic sleeve.
Preferably, the positioning assembly comprises a positioning seat, positioning holes are fixedly formed in two sides of the inside of the positioning seat, and positioning grooves are fixedly formed in two sides of the top of the positioning seat.
Compared with the prior art, the beneficial effects of the utility model are that:
1. the utility model discloses an install locating component, can utilize locating hole cooperation pilot pin to fix this device, the dismouting is simple, and the staff of being convenient for assembles work, utilizes the constant head tank to install flexible subassembly after that.
2. The utility model discloses a top fixed mounting at the inserted block has adjusting part, can utilize slot and inserted block to carry out swing joint, when the alignment jig damaged, can utilize the slot to take out the alignment jig and change.
3. The utility model discloses a there is flexible subassembly in the both sides all movable mounting at locating component top, can unscrew the gim peg, adjusts the height of telescopic link after that, then screws up the gim peg and fixes, and the staff of being convenient for adjusts.
4. The utility model discloses a fixed valve body that is provided with in the top of flexible subassembly, can utilize the external connecting bolt of mounting hole cooperation to carry out swing joint with this device and external equipment, the dismouting is simple, and the staff of being convenient for carries out maintenance work.
5. The utility model discloses a run through in the inside of valve body and install the valve rod, can utilize the valve rod to drive the valve and carry out the ball valve and open and close easy operation.

Referring to fig. 1-4, the present invention provides an embodiment: a full-bore welded steel ball valve comprises a valve body 3, a telescopic component 4 and a positioning component 5, wherein the telescopic component 4 is movably mounted on two sides of the top of the positioning component 5, the telescopic component 4 can unscrew an adjusting bolt 402, then the height of a telescopic rod 401 is adjusted, then the adjusting bolt 402 is screwed for fixing, and the device is convenient for workers to adjust, the positioning component 5 can be fixed by matching a positioning hole 503 with a positioning bolt 7, the device is simple to disassemble and assemble, the workers can conveniently assemble, then the telescopic component 4 is installed by using a positioning groove 502, the top of the telescopic component 4 is fixedly provided with the valve body 3, the valve body 3 can be movably connected with external equipment by matching an installation hole 303 with an external connection bolt, the disassembly and assembly are simple, the workers can conveniently maintain, a valve rod 2 is installed inside the valve body 3 in a penetrating manner, the valve rod 2 can drive a valve 201 to open and close the ball valve, easy operation, the top fixed mounting of valve rod 2 has inserted block 6, and the top fixed mounting of inserted block 6 has adjusting part 1, and adjusting part 1 can utilize slot 102 and inserted block 6 to carry out swing joint, and when alignment jig 101 damaged, can utilize slot 102 to take out alignment jig 101 and change, and the inside both sides of positioning part 5 all run through and install the pilot pin 7.
Further, adjusting part 1 includes alignment jig 101, and the fixed slot 102 that is provided with in bottom of alignment jig 101, when this device carries out the during operation, can utilize slot 102 and inserted block 6 to carry out swing joint, when alignment jig 101 damaged, can utilize slot 102 to take out alignment jig 101 and change.
Further, the fixed valve 201 that is provided with in bottom of valve rod 2, and the fixed disk seat 202 that is provided with in bottom of valve 201, when this device carries out the during operation, can utilize valve rod 2 to drive valve 201 and carry out the ball valve and open and close, easy operation can utilize mounting hole 303 to cooperate external connecting bolt to carry out swing joint with this device and external equipment, and the dismouting is simple, and the staff of being convenient for carries out maintenance work.
Further, the fixed full siphunculus 301 that is provided with in inside of valve body 3, the both sides of full siphunculus 301 are all fixed and are provided with mounting disc 302, and the inside both ends of mounting disc 302 are all fixed and are provided with mounting hole 303, when this device carries out the during operation, can utilize mounting hole 303 cooperation external connecting bolt to carry out swing joint with this device and external equipment, and the dismouting is simple, and the staff of being convenient for carries out maintenance work.
Further, telescopic component 4 includes telescopic tube 403, and telescopic tube 403's inside movable mounting has telescopic link 401, and telescopic tube 403's both sides all movable mounting has adjusting bolt 402, and when this device carried out work, can unscrew adjusting bolt 402, followed the height of adjusting telescopic link 401, then screwed up adjusting bolt 402 and fixed, the staff of being convenient for adjusts.
Further, locating component 5 includes positioning seat 501, and positioning seat 501 is inside both sides all to be fixed and is provided with locating hole 503, and the both sides at positioning seat 501 top are all fixed and are provided with constant head tank 502, when this device carries out the during operation, can utilize locating hole 503 cooperation pilot pin 7 to fix this device, and the dismouting is simple, and the staff of being convenient for carries out equipment work, utilizes constant head tank 502 to install telescopic component 4 afterwards.
The working principle is as follows: before using this device, the user detects the device earlier, confirm not having the problem after, in the time of using, utilize locating hole 503 cooperation gim peg 7 to fix this device earlier, the dismouting is simple, the staff of being convenient for carries out equipment work, utilize constant head tank 502 to install flexible subassembly 4 after that, unscrew adjusting bolt 402 after that, adjust telescopic link 401's height after that, then it fixes to screw up adjusting bolt 402, the staff of being convenient for adjusts, utilize mounting hole 303 cooperation external connecting bolt to carry out swing joint with this device and external equipment with this device after that, the dismouting is simple, the staff of being convenient for carries out maintenance work, then utilize slot 102 and inserted block 6 to carry out swing joint, when alignment jig 101 damages, can utilize slot 102 to take out alignment jig 101 to change.
